    Learn more about Museology degree programs in Austria

    Studying Museology in Austria offers a unique intersection of art, history, and cultural management. This field focuses on understanding museum practices, curatorial strategies, and cultural preservation, preparing you for impactful roles in the art and heritage sectors.

    Through applied coursework, you'll dive into topics like exhibit design, collections management, and visitor engagement. This practical instruction fosters an environment for students to refine their critical thinking and problem-solving skills as they engage with current challenges in museology. Those studying in Austria benefit from the country's rich cultural heritage, allowing for meaningful exploration of local and international museum practices.

    Students build adaptability as they navigate diverse perspectives in Austrian museums, shaping their understanding of global heritage issues. Career paths typically include roles such as museum curator, conservation specialist, or cultural policy advisor. Graduating from a Museology program equips you with skills valued worldwide, empowering you to contribute significantly to the global cultural landscape.
